JEE Advanced 2026 Marks vs Rank: Aspirants can check the expected JEE Advanced 2026 marks vs rank details on this page. IIT Roorkee will publish the JEE Advanced 2026 rank data on June 1, 2026, on the official website, jeeadv.ac.in. By then, the expected JEE Advanced 2026 rank vs marks information has been provided based on the previous year’s trends. Candidates who get 200 marks in JEE Advanced 2026 out of a total of 360 will get a rank around 1,000. The authority will release the JEE advanced results in the form of ranks. The below-given table of expected JEE Advanced marks vs rank 2026 has been taken based on the previous years' official data.
| Rank Range | Expected Marks |
|---|---|
1 – 1000 | 244 – 292 |
1000 – 5000 | 208 – 243 |
5000 – 10,000 | 187 – 207 |
10,000 – 20,000 | 164 – 186 |
20,000 – 30,000 | 148 – 163 |
30,000 – 40,000 | 136 – 147 |
40,000 – 50,000 | 128 – 135 |
50,000 – 60,000 | 120 – 127 |
60,000 – 70,000 | 113 – 119 |
70,000 – 80,000 | 107 – 112 |
80,000 – 90,000 | 101 – 106 |
90,000 – 1,00,000 | 96 – 100 |
1,00,000 – 1,20,000 | 89 – 95 |
1,20,000 – 1,40,000 | 82 – 88 |
1,40,000 – 1,60,000 | 76 – 81 |
1,60,000 – 1,80,000 | 71 – 75 |
1,80,000 – 2,00,000 | 67 – 70 |
2,00,000 – 2,20,000 | 64 – 66 |
2,20,000 – 2,40,000 | 60 – 63 |
Candidates need to get the JEE Advanced qualifying cutoff marks to be eligible to be part of the JEE Advanced rank list 2026. The admission cutoff is the minimum JEE Advanced cutoff essential for the students to secure admission into IITs. Below is the expected JEE Advanced marks vs rank 2026 for qualifying marks.
| Category | JEE Advanced 2026 Qualifying Percentage (Expected) | JEE Advanced Qualifying Marks 2026 (Expected) | JEE Advanced Qualifying Rank 2026 (Expected) |
|---|---|---|---|
General Candidates | 35% | 126 | 50,987 |
OBC-NCL/EWS | 31.5% | 113.4 | 69.293 |
SC/ST/PwD | 17.5% | 63 | 2,22,591 |

As per the previous year’s JEE Advanced qualified cutoff of 20% for general candidates, which means 74 marks out of 360 were required to be qualified in the JEE Advanced exam. To secure a seat in the IIT institute, candidates have to score around 120 marks, of which the rank will be around 60,000. However, the CSE branch can be obtained if students score more than 200 marks out of the total JEE Advanced marks.
